CVE-2023-36752 is a command injection vulnerability affecting multiple Siemens RUGGEDCOM ROX devices running versions prior to V2.16.0. An authenticated, privileged remote attacker can exploit a lack of server-side input sanitation in the 'upgrade-app' URL parameter to execute arbitrary code with root privileges. This vulnerability carries a CVSS score of 7.2 (High), indicating a high imp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ability with low attack complexity. While there is no known active exploitation or publicly available exploit code in Metasploit, Nuclei, or ExploitDB, the vulnerability has garnered significant community discussion, suggesting awareness and potential for future exploitation.
